Whats up guy's. So in the works is a turbo 6.0 so far this is what ive put together..

Wiseco PTS523AS -4cc tru pro pistons
Eagle or Scat H-beam rods ARP2000 (Compstars are a little bit out of budget)
Stock Crank
LS2 timing chain
Sloppy 228/230 cam
Ls9 headgaskets
Ebay Headstuds

Already have PAC 1218 Springs
Already have 4l80e

Open to recommendations!

yeah dump the ls2 timing chain!

i just had one let go under 10k miles in my zo6 475/415 hp/tq bent 14 valves and some pistons are marked up dont make the same mistake i did

katech c5r or Elite Drive Chain its what im going to go with and its what the high HP corvette guys are running, im not the only one the ls2 let go on
